COVID Statement

We welcome you all to the Maine All-Day Singing!


PLEASE consider testing before you come to the All-Day. With many asymptomatic cases of COVID out there, testing is the best way to avoid inadvertently infecting your friends and fellow singers.

IF you have not yet been vaccinated, we ask that you please follow CDC guidelines and MASK and DISTANCE yourselves for your own protection and for the love and care for your fellow singers.

IF you have been vaccinated but have any hesitation about the size of the crowd, the activity of singing, or our proximity to each other, please feel that you can also MASK and DISTANCE without any judgement on anyone else’s part.

IF you develop any symptoms of COVID, or are diagnosed with COVID after this singing, please get in touch with Eric Sandberg at: hea...@mainesacredharp.org. He can then begin the process of notifying everyone at this event about the need to quarantine and get tested.  YOUR IDENTITY WILL BE COMPLETELY PROTECTED, anonymity is guaranteed. This will protect both the health and the confidence of the wider singing community in the coming months. We do not want the Maine All-Day to be a super-spreader event!!
